A cost comparison for a full-time employee versus a Virtual Assistant
| COST COMPARISON | Full-time Employee | Virtual Assistant |
| Hourly Rate of Pay | $20.00 | $35.00 |
| Fringe Benefits @ 35% (Health/Dental/Life Insurance, Retirement Plans) |
$7.00 | None |
| Overhead Rate @ 50% (Office Space, Equipment & Office Supply Expense, UI Insurance, Worker’s Compensation, Overtime Pay, Administration Costs) | $10.00 | None |
| Total Effective Rate of Pay | $37.00 | $35.00 |
| **Hours Per Year | 2,080 hrs | 480 hrs |
| TOTAL Annual Labour Cost | $76,960.00 | $16,800.00 |
Difference = $60,160.00 per year
By hiring a Virtual Assistant…
You SAVE over $60,000.00 per year!
Although the Virtual Assistant’s hourly rate is more than the employee’s rate in the first place, you save the cost of benefits and overhead that would have to be applied to the new employee’s wage. And, because Virtual Assistant’s are usually more experienced, more efficient, and better connected than the employee, you’ll need to devote far less time to the project to get the same results, only 480 hours a year versus 2,080 for the new employee.
